Was Bobby Green released by the UFC? A recent update to the popular UFC Roster Watch website certainly implied that was the case. UFC Roster Watch automatically tracks changes to the UFC’s rankings ballot. When a fighter is released by the UFC, it’s one of the first places that gets updated. That makes the Roster Watch twitter account one of the fastest ways to learn a UFC athlete has retired or been cut.

Ben Askren has become synonymous with Jorge Masvidal after he suffered a 5 second knockout at the hands of ‘Gamebred’ in 2019. The former ONE and Bellator welterweight champion shot for an early takedown but was caught by a flying knee. It was an iconic finish for Masvidal. The stoppage that launched a thousand memes. In reality, it was probably a lot more that that. The moment was so significant for Masvidal that he even got it tattooed on his shoulder and turned into t-shirts.
